Abstract

Among the various strategies of business research, the case study approach is sometimes grouped in the category of research-action and sometimes in that of exploratory qualitative studies. Is not this type of research, which is in fat little known an little used by scholars of management, of deep methodological and theoretical interest, This is what the author shows, after having underlined the great variety of possible application of this method, in advancing a certain number of prerequisites for the use and in studying its particular characteristics.
